Parlex Reports Financial Results for the Fourth Quarter and Fiscal Year 2003
September 4, 2003 |Estimated reading time: Less than a minute
Methuen, Mass. — Parlex Corp. reported revenues of $18.8 million in the quarter ended June 30, 2003, versus $23.5 million for the same period in the previous fiscal year.
Operating loss was $2.1 million versus $7.5 million for the same period of the preceding year. No tax benefit was recorded associated with U.S. operating losses. As a result, the company reported a net loss for the quarter of $2.3 million or 36 cents per share versus $4.9 million or 77 cents per share for the same period last year.
For the fiscal year 2003, revenues were $82.8 million versus $87 million in fiscal 2002. The operating loss for fiscal 2003 was $12.5 million compared to $17.7 million in the prior year. In fiscal 2003, the company established a full valuation reserve totaling $6.9 million for all U.S. deferred tax assets as well as recording no tax benefit on U.S. operating losses. Accordingly, net loss was $19.5 million for fiscal 2003 ($3.09 per share) versus $10.4 million for fiscal 2002 ($1.65 per share).
Parlex Corp. is a world leader in the design and manufacture of flexible, interconnect products.
